Certified Occupational Therapist Assistant (COTA) Pediatrics
Madison , AL | Full-time
Are you ready to make therapy fun, impactful, and full of heart?
We're searching for a Certified Occupational Therapy Assistant who thrives in a playful, child-centered environment and is excited to help kids grow in confidence, skills, and independence. Join a team that truly supports one anotherand the families we serve.
Bring your creativity, compassion, and energy. Lets change lives together!
Expectations:
- Complete all documentation in a timely manner (point-of-service SOAP notes are encouraged).
- Notify the Lead OT when resources, evaluations, or protocols need to be ordered.
- Attend weekly staff meetings and contribute to collaborative care.
- Provide scheduled treatment to assigned patients, including all tasks necessary for effective care.
- Submit treatment charges before leaving the clinic each day.
- Maintain a clean and organized therapy environment.
- Communicate any clinical concerns to the Lead OT.
- Participate in community outreach and SpOT Clinic social media initiatives.
- Model and share The SpOT Clinics positive culture and core values with families and the community.
- Promote open communication, accountability, and teamwork across the clinic.
- Support clinic leadership, including the Lead OT, Clinic Manager, COO, CFO, and CEO.
- Demonstrate reliability, professionalism, creativity, and problem-solving skills.
Qualifications:
- Professional demeanor and conduct at all times.
- Proficiency with computers and comfort using creative tools and digital platforms.
- Familiarity with ADL evaluation tools and pediatric treatment strategies.
- Ability to work effectively with children with diverse needs, personalities, and behaviors.
- Up-to-date knowledge of occupational therapy practices and a desire for continued growth.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
- Valid Alabama license to practice as a Certified Occupational Therapy Assistant (or in process).
- Comfortable using Google Suite professionally.
